Career Roles in Exoplanet Atmospheres

Exoplanet Atmospheric Scientist: Focuses on analyzing the chemical composition and dynamics of exoplanet atmospheres to determine their habitability.
Astronomical Data Analyst: Responsible for interpreting data from telescopes and satellites to extract meaningful insights about exoplanet atmospheres.
Astrobiologist: Studies the potential for life in exoplanets by examining the atmospheres for biosignatures and other indicators of habitability.
Planetary Climate Modeler: Develops and utilizes computer models to simulate the climate and weather patterns of exoplanets based on atmospheric data.
Remote Sensing Specialist: Employs remote sensing technologies to gather data on the atmospheric conditions of distant exoplanets.
